Signs Your Heating System Needs Immediate Attention

Strange Noises During Startup

You might hear unusual sounds like grinding, squealing, rattling, or banging when your heater starts up or runs. These noises often indicate mechanical issues such as a failing motor bearing, a loose fan belt, or debris caught in the blower fan. In the coastal environment of Vero Beach, it is not uncommon for small critters or excessive dust to settle in dormant units, causing these disruptive sounds upon startup.

Ignoring strange noises can lead to accelerated wear on vital components and much more expensive repairs down the line. For commercial properties, a noisy heating system can disrupt your business environment, annoy customers, and impact employee productivity. A simple professional lubrication or cleaning during a routine tune-up can prevent a complete system breakdown that leaves you without heat.

Uneven Heating or Cold Spots

Certain rooms or areas of your home or business might feel significantly colder than others, even when the heating system is running continuously. This often points to issues with airflow, such as clogged air filters, leaky ductwork, or improperly balanced vents. It could also signal a problem with the heating unit's ability to distribute warmth efficiently across your entire floor plan.

Uneven heating leads to constant discomfort and forces your system to work harder to compensate for the temperature gaps. In larger commercial spaces or multi-story homes, uneven heating creates distinct zones of discomfort that frustrate occupants. This drives up your energy bills and can also be a symptom of larger underlying ductwork issues that negatively impact your overall indoor air quality.

Increased Energy Bills

Even for the relatively infrequent use of heating in our area, your utility bills might be higher than expected when your heater is running. An unexpected jump in energy costs indicates your heating system is losing efficiency and struggling to do its job. This is often due to neglected maintenance, clogged filters, worn components, or a struggling furnace that has to run longer cycles to maintain your desired temperature.

Higher energy bills directly impact your monthly budget while signaling that your system is under severe stress. Commercial facilities with neglected heating systems often see massive spikes in overhead costs due to inefficient operation. An inefficient system is highly prone to premature failure and will eventually require more frequent, costly interventions.

Musty or Burning Smells

You might detect a dusty, musty, or even burning odor when your heating system first turns on, particularly after a long period of inactivity. A dusty smell usually means debris has accumulated in the system and ductwork during the long off-season and is burning off as the heater starts. However, a burning plastic or electrical smell is far more serious and could indicate an overheating component, a failing motor, or a dangerous electrical issue.

While a brief dusty smell often dissipates, it remains a clear sign your system desperately needs a thorough cleaning. A persistent or burning smell can be a severe safety hazard that requires immediate professional attention to protect your property. High humidity can also contribute to mold or mildew growth in neglected ductwork, leading to lingering musty odors that ruin your indoor air quality.

Frequent Cycling or Short Bursts of Heat

Your heating system might turn on and off frequently in short bursts, rather than running for longer, consistent cycles to warm the space. This short cycling can be caused by an oversized unit, a malfunctioning thermostat, or a clogged air filter restricting critical airflow. It can also happen when a safety limit switch trips repeatedly due to internal overheating within the furnace or air handler.

Short cycling puts excessive mechanical strain on your heating system's components, leading to premature wear and tear. It drastically reduces your energy efficiency and makes it incredibly difficult to maintain a consistent, comfortable temperature. Addressing this quickly prevents the system from burning out its own motors and relays.

What Causes Heating System Issues in Vero Beach

Understanding why your heater struggles can help you prevent future breakdowns and extend the life of your equipment. Coastal environments present specific challenges for residential and commercial climate control systems.

Neglected Annual Heating Maintenance

Many property owners prioritize their air conditioning systems, often overlooking their heating equipment due to its less frequent use. Over time, this lack of attention allows small, easily fixable issues to escalate into major mechanical failures. Because our systems often go months without being used, there is a false perception that maintenance is not as critical.

A thorough annual heating tune-up ensures all components are clean, lubricated, and operating correctly before you actually need them. Catching minor wear and tear early prevents sudden breakdowns and keeps your system running at peak efficiency all year long.

Dust and Debris Accumulation

During long periods of inactivity, heating system components like the blower motor, coils, and air filters accumulate significant amounts of dust, pet dander, and airborne particles. This heavy buildup restricts airflow, forcing the system to work twice as hard to push warm air into your living or workspaces. Our coastal breezes, fine sand, and humid conditions contribute heavily to particulate matter settling in dormant HVAC systems.

Professional cleaning of the heating unit removes this restrictive buildup and restores proper airflow. Regular filter replacements and professional attention ensure your system does not suffocate under layers of accumulated debris.

Electrical Component Wear and Tear

Over time, vital electrical components like capacitors, relays, and wiring degrade, especially with the intermittent use typical of local heating systems. These parts are absolutely critical for starting the unit and keeping it running safely. High humidity and coastal salt air can accelerate corrosion on these electrical connections, making them prone to failure when the system is finally energized.

Routine inspection and testing of all electrical connections prevent dangerous shorts and sudden system failures. Replacing worn or corroded parts proactively ensures safe, reliable operation whenever you adjust the thermostat.

Thermostat Malfunctions or Miscalibration

A faulty or improperly calibrated thermostat can send incorrect signals to your heating system, leading to short cycling or the system failing to turn on at all. Older properties might have outdated thermostats that are simply less accurate or prone to mechanical wear. Even newer digital thermostats can sometimes lose calibration or develop frustrating software glitches over time.

Testing and recalibrating the existing thermostat restores accurate communication between your controls and your heating equipment. In many cases, upgrading to a newer model provides precise temperature control and better energy management for your property.

What to Expect During Your Heating Maintenance Visit

When an Anna's Air, Heat And Plumbing technician arrives at your property, you can expect a thorough, professional service designed to optimize your system's performance. Our licensed technicians begin with a comprehensive inspection of your entire heating unit, evaluating both indoor and outdoor components. We check all electrical connections for safety and wear, lubricate moving parts to reduce mechanical friction, and inspect the burner assembly and heat exchanger for any signs of dangerous damage or cracks.

Next, we meticulously clean the blower motor, fan, and coils to ensure optimal airflow throughout your property. We will replace your air filter, check the thermostat for pinpoint accuracy, and test all critical safety controls to guarantee your system operates without risk. The True Cost of Delaying Heating Maintenance

Ignoring necessary heating maintenance can lead to several costly and highly inconvenient consequences for your property. A neglected system is significantly more prone to unexpected breakdowns, often failing precisely when you need it most. This results in severe discomfort and the immediate, unbudgeted expense of emergency repairs.

An inefficient heater will also consume far more energy to do the same amount of work, driving up your monthly utility bills unnecessarily. Minor issues left unaddressed rapidly escalate into major, expensive repairs or can even completely destroy the unit, necessitating a premature system replacement. This is a far greater financial burden than simply investing in routine preventative maintenance.

For business owners, a sudden heating failure can mean dealing with unhappy patrons or an unproductive workforce. Finally, neglecting regular professional maintenance can easily void your manufacturer's warranty. This leaves you entirely financially responsible for component failures and repairs that would have otherwise been fully covered by the manufacturer.
